RVshare also lets you choose from a variety of vehicles so you can pick the one that best suits your needs. Traveling with a large group or with people who want bathrooms and showers? You likely want a Class A motorhome for your journey. If you’re willing to forgo a few perks and are traveling with a very small group, a Class B campervan may be all you need. Finally, a Class C camper is a good mix of both other options - it’s not as large as a Class A motorhome, but it has more amenities than a Class B camper. RVshare also has A-frame trailers, 5th wheels, teardrop trailers, and a host of other options for camping and enjoying the outdoors.

Lilburn is a city in Gwinnett County, Georgia, United States. The city is a northeast suburb of Atlanta. Lilburn was founded in 1890 by Lilburn Trigg Myers. The city was named after Myers' middle name. Prior to Myers' arrival, the area now encompassing Lilburn was inhabited by the Cherokee people. Lilburn is home to several parks and recreation facilities, including Lilburn City Park, Camp Creek Golf Course, and Stone Mountain Park.
